Graphing Mathematica uses a powerful combination of mathematical algorithms and visualization techniques to create stunning visual representations of mathematical concepts. The software allows users to input mathematical equations, functions, and data sets, which are then rendered into interactive 3D graphs and visualizations. With its intuitive interface and extensive libraries of pre-built functions, Graphing Mathematica makes it easy for users to explore complex mathematical relationships and gain insights into data-driven problems.

While Graphing Mathematica offers numerous benefits, there are also potential risks and challenges to consider. For instance, users may struggle to interpret and understand complex visualizations, or encounter difficulties in using the software for specific applications. Additionally, the high-end capabilities of Graphing Mathematica may not be suitable for all users, particularly those with limited computational resources or expertise.
